Output 38c39ac1831a4252b2d0024d3ce843eaa27319983661bb4911acd8ea7da9a811:0

value
284102858
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 05f438a63f3148531b809212ad687c1934ef89b7 OP_EQUALVERIFY OP_CHECKSIG
address
LKmSCxuLRRXhe1uMC68FG2JAYUJ62DdboK
transaction
38c39ac1831a4252b2d0024d3ce843eaa27319983661bb4911acd8ea7da9a811
spent
true